What is the process for moving into an assisted living facility in Hyde Park, UT?
The process of moving into an assisted living facility in Hyde Park, UT, generally involves several steps to ensure a smooth transition. First, families should research and tour multiple facilities to find the one that best meets their loved one's needs. Once a facility is chosen, the next step is to complete a thorough assessment, typically conducted by the facility's staff or a healthcare professional, to determine the level of care required. After the assessment, the resident and their family will review and sign the residency agreement, which outlines the services provided, costs, and terms of residence. It’s important to carefully read and understand this contract. The final steps involve planning the move, which includes downsizing, packing, and organizing the resident's belongings. Many facilities offer moving services or can recommend companies that specialize in senior relocations. Coordination with the facility staff is key during this time to ensure a seamless transition.
How do assisted living facilities handle medical emergencies?
Assisted living facilities should be equipped to handle medical emergencies with well-established protocols to ensure resident safety. As a general rule, assisted living facilities should have trained staff available 24/7 who can respond immediately to any emergency. In the event of a medical crisis, staff members should be trained to provide basic first aid, administer CPR, and call 911 if necessary. Facilities often have emergency alert systems in place, such as call buttons in residents' rooms, which allow them to quickly request assistance. Additionally, many assisted living communities have partnerships with nearby hospitals and medical centers, ensuring prompt access to advanced medical care. Family members are typically notified as soon as possible in the event of an emergency. Some facilities also have on-site healthcare professionals, such as nurses or doctors, who can provide immediate care and assess the situation before determining whether hospitalization is required.

How do assisted living facilities in Utah ensure the safety and security of their residents?
Safety and security are top priorities for assisted living facilities. To ensure a safe environment, many facilities are equipped with 24-hour security systems, including controlled access points, surveillance cameras, and alarm systems that monitor for unauthorized entry. Residents often have access to emergency call systems in their rooms and common areas, allowing them to quickly request help if needed. Many facilities employ trained security personnel who monitor the premises and assist in enforcing safety protocols. In addition to physical security measures, facilities often implement comprehensive safety policies that include regular fire drills, emergency preparedness training for staff, and stringent infection control procedures. Staff members should also be trained in de-escalation techniques and first aid, ensuring they are prepared to handle various situations.
